MtBird低代码平台实战:从零构建企业级应用

MtBird低代码平台实战:从零构建企业级应用

【免费下载链接】mtbird 💻 无代码编辑器,无需代码生成小程序、H5页面和网站 ,拖拽操作、样式配置快速生成页面应用,数据可视化接入,支持定制业务拓展插件. StaringOS MtBird is a low-code platform for HTML Pages 、 Websites. We help users build pages without code or less code. 【免费下载链接】mtbird 项目地址: https://gitcode.com/gh_mirrors/mt/mtbird

在当今快节奏的数字化时代,企业迫切需要快速响应市场变化的应用开发能力。MtBird作为一款功能强大的低代码平台,让你无需深厚的技术背景也能构建专业的Web应用。本文将带你从环境准备到项目部署,完整体验MtBird的开发流程。

环境准备与项目初始化

开始之前,确保你的开发环境满足以下要求:

  • Node.js 版本 18 或更高
  • Git 版本控制系统
  • 现代浏览器(Chrome、Firefox、Safari)

项目克隆是第一步,使用以下命令获取最新代码:

git clone https://gitcode.com/gh_mirrors/mt/mtbird
cd mtbird

依赖安装是整个项目的基础,MtBird使用PNPM作为包管理工具:

pnpm install

编辑器界面

核心功能深度体验

可视化页面构建

MtBird最强大的功能在于其拖拽式页面构建能力。通过简单的鼠标操作,你可以:

  • 添加预置组件到画布
  • 实时调整组件样式和布局
  • 配置数据源和交互逻辑

数据管理配置

平台内置了完整的数据管理模块,支持:

  • 数据库表结构可视化配置
  • API接口快速对接
  • 表单数据动态绑定

实战案例:企业官网搭建

让我们通过一个实际案例来展示MtBird的强大功能。假设你需要为一个初创公司搭建官网,包含首页、产品展示、联系我们等页面。

第一步是创建页面结构:

// 在编辑器中创建基础布局
const pageStructure = {
  header: '导航栏组件',
  hero: '轮播图组件', 
  features: '产品特性展示',
  footer: '底部信息'

页面结构示例

高级功能探索

自定义组件开发

当预置组件无法满足需求时,你可以开发自定义组件。参考组件开发文档了解详细流程。

插件系统集成

MtBird支持丰富的插件生态,包括:

  • 动画效果插件
  • 图表可视化插件
  • 第三方服务集成插件

常见问题解决方案

在开发过程中,你可能会遇到以下问题:

依赖安装失败 检查Node.js版本是否符合要求,清理缓存后重新安装:

pnpm store prune
pnpm install

页面渲染异常 通常是由于组件配置错误导致,建议:

  1. 检查组件属性设置
  2. 验证数据源连接
  3. 查看浏览器控制台错误信息

项目部署指南

完成开发后,你可以通过以下方式部署应用:

静态部署 适用于纯前端项目,生成静态文件后上传至任何Web服务器。

服务端部署 需要Node.js环境的全栈应用,配置生产环境变量后启动服务。

后续学习路径

掌握了基础使用后,建议你进一步学习:

  • 高级数据绑定技巧
  • 性能优化最佳实践
  • 企业级应用架构设计

MtBird为不同技术水平的开发者提供了平等的创新机会。无论你是产品经理、设计师还是全栈工程师,都能在这个平台上找到适合自己的开发方式。开始你的低代码开发之旅,将创意快速转化为现实。

【免费下载链接】mtbird 💻 无代码编辑器,无需代码生成小程序、H5页面和网站 ,拖拽操作、样式配置快速生成页面应用,数据可视化接入,支持定制业务拓展插件. StaringOS MtBird is a low-code platform for HTML Pages 、 Websites. We help users build pages without code or less code. 【免费下载链接】mtbird 项目地址: https://gitcode.com/gh_mirrors/mt/mtbird

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值